Rating: 5
Summary: Perfect for Real World Techies
Comment: Let's face reality, Micro$oft modifed the MCSE 2000 exams so that simple memorization wouldn't be enough to pass (ie: the MCSE NT 4 "Paper Certification"). They were designed for people already in the IT/Computer industry. If you're not working in a tech related field, and you don't have at least SOME access to the hardware/software, you're gonna have issues.

That said, lemme say that these books are perfect for "Real World Techies".

I can't speak about other books in this series, but I can say as a former programmer and current IT Manager (yes, I got coder's burn out), I breezed through the first 4 tests with these books.

Read through one, take a practice test (I'm partial to Transcender), go over the weak spots, take another practice exam just to make sure I got it down, and take the exam.

I averaged one test every two weeks. Passed every time.

This is not to say the tests are easy. Nor are these books "all inclusive" But I manage a 10 server 50+ node 3 domain network that was entirely NT 4/Win98. Doing the migration after I passed the tests was a breeze.

I only needed one other book outside of these 4...and that was because TCP/IP sub netting can be a pain in the butt. (as we are all aware)

If you're a techie, and are thinking about taking the exams, buy this cluster of books. If you're solid with the basics of NT4, you'll never regret buying these.
